So I'm in the market to replace my clutch and shift linkage ables for a 2008 5 speed manual fit I'm opting out of the clutch masters clutch kits as they only have aluminum fly wheels that fit for them and I'd rather have steal or oem iron my question is what's the best alternative upgrade clutch kit ?

I work in the Euro automotive aftermarket and our customers love their LUK and Valeo kits, maybe favoring the LUK units a bit more.
For previous Hondas, I've liked my Exedy replacement kits. They're usually pretty reasonably-priced for the quality you're getting.
I also have seen that XCLUTCH now has a GD3 kit, which I'm pretty interested in. They're newer AFAIK and nobody I know is running them yet, but they're supposed to come with basically every single piece of hardware you would need brand-new. Not sure if they have a dual-mass kit for you though or if it would involve a single mass conversion by default.
Just remember, these cars make almost no juice. No point in going Stage-XX just to make it heinous to drive on the street.
